Academic Year to Begin Aug. 24 with First Day of Classes; Freshmen Arrive Friday
8/9/2011
GREENVILLE, S.C.—The 2011-12 academic year at Furman University will officially get underway Wednesday, Aug. 24 when students attend their first day of classes.
Approximately 800 freshmen will report to campus Friday, Aug. 19 and take part in orientation activities through Aug. 23. The rest of the university’s 2,700 students will begin arriving on Sunday, Aug. 21.
Furman will hold its opening convocation Thursday, Sept. 1 at 10 a.m. in McAlister Auditorium.
The fall term ends Dec. 6, while spring term begins Jan. 9 and ends April 24. Commencement will be held Saturday, May 5. The optional May Experience term will run May 9-30.
